UniqueName (MDX)
Devuelve el nombre único de una dimensión, jerarquía, nivel o miembro especificado.
Sintaxis
Dimension expression syntax
Dimension_Expression.UniqueName
Hierarchy expression syntax
Hierarchy_Expression.UniqueName
Level expression syntax
Level_Expression.UniqueName
Member expression syntax
Member_Expression.UniqueName
Argumentos
Dimension_Expression
Expresión MDX (Expresiones multidimensionales) válida que se resuelve en una dimensión.Hierarchy_Expression
Expresión MDX válida que devuelve una jerarquía.Level_Expression
Expresión MDX válida que devuelve un nivel.Member_Expression
Expresión MDX válida que devuelve un miembro.
Comentarios
La función UniqueName devuelve el nombre único del objeto, no el nombre que devuelve la función Name. El nombre devuelto no incluye el nombre del cubo. Los resultados devueltos dependen de la configuración del servidor o de la propiedad de cadena de conexión MDX Unique Name Style.
Ejemplo
El ejemplo siguiente devuelve el valor de nombre único de la dimensión Product, la jerarquía Product Categories, el nivel Subcategory y el miembro Bike Racks del cubo Adventure Works.
WITH MEMBER DimensionUniqueName
AS [Product].UniqueName
MEMBER HierarchyUniqueName
AS [Product].[Product Categories].UniqueName
MEMBER LevelUniqueName
AS [Product].[Product Categories].[Subcategory].UniqueName
MEMBER MemberUniqueName
AS [Product].[Product Categories].[Subcategory].[Bike Racks]
SELECT
{DimensionUniqueName
, HierarchyUniqueName
, LevelUniqueName
, MemberUniqueName }
ON 0
FROM [Adventure Works]